Context Attentive Bandits: Contextual Bandit with Restricted Context
We consider a novel formulation of the multi-armed bandit model, which we
call the contextual bandit with restricted context, where only a limited number
of features can be accessed by the learner at every iteration. This novel
formulation is motivated by different online problems arising in clinical
trials, recommender systems and attention modeling. Herein, we adapt the
standard multi-armed bandit algorithm known as Thompson Sampling to take
advantage of our restricted context setting, and propose two novel algorithms,
called the Thompson Sampling with Restricted Context(TSRC) and the Windows
Thompson Sampling with Restricted Context(WTSRC), for handling stationary and
nonstationary environments, respectively. Our empirical results demonstrate

Intercalibration of the Hb3gr 40Ar/39Ar dating standard.
The 40Ar/39Ar dating technique is based on the knowledge of the age of neutron fluence monitors (standards). Recent investigations have improved the accuracy and precision of the ages of most of the Phanerozoic-aged standards (e.g. Fish Canyon Tuff sanidine (FCs), Alder Creek sanidine, GA1550 biotite and LP-6 biotite); however, no specific study has been undertaken on the older standards (i.e. Hb3gr hornblende and NL-25 hornblende) generally used to date Precambrian, high Ca/K, and/or meteoritic rocks.In this study, we show that Hb3gr hornblende is relatively homogenous in age, composition (Ca/K) and atmospheric contamination at the single grain level. The mean standard deviation of the 40Ar/39ArK (F-value) derived from this study is 0.49%, comparable to the most homogeneous standards. The intercalibration factor (which allows direct comparison between standards) between Hb3gr and FCs is RFCsHb3gr = 51.945 0.167. Using an age of 28.02 Ma for FCs, the age of Hb3gr derived from the R-value is 1073.6 5.3 Ma (1σ, internal error only) and 8.8 Ma (including all sources of error). This age is indistinguishable within uncertainty from the K/Ar age previously reported at 1072 11 Ma [Turner G., Huneke, J.C., Podosek, F.A., Wasserburg, G.J., 1971. 40Ar-39Ar ages and cosmic ray exposure ages of Apollo 14 samples. Earth Planet. Sci. Lett. 12, 19-35]. The R-value determined in this study can also be used to intercalibrate FCs if we consider the K/Ar date of 1072 Ma as a reference age for Hb3gr. We derive an age of 27.95 0.19 Ma (1σ, internal error only) for FCs which is in agreement with the previous determinations. Altogether, this shows that Hb3gr is a suitable standard for 40Ar/39Ar geochronology
Is first-gen an identity? How first-generation college students make meaning of institutional and familial constructs of self
Institutions increasingly use first-generation categorizations to provide support to students. In this study, we sought to understand how students make meaning of their first-generation status by conducting a series of focus groups with 54 participants. Our findings reveal that students saw first-generation status as an organizational and familial identity rather than a social identities. This status was connected to alterity and social distance that was most salient in comparison to continuing-generation peers. Our recommendations include re-examining the role of first- generation specific programming on campus, creating opportunities for meaning-making, supporting students within changing family dynamics, and exploring the interaction between first-generation status and other marginalized identities

Noisy image restoration using Markov random field in a multiresolution scheme
The restoration methods involving Markov random fields with line
process for the discontinuities are known to give good results in edge
preserving image restoration . The Markov model is developped on the
image decomposed at several resolutions using a wavelet transform . A
deterministic relaxation algorithm (GNC) performs the minimization of
the non convex criterion . Several multiresolution algorithms are developped
and results are compared with those in monoresolution . These multiresolution algorithms provide better results with less computation
time .La modélisation de l'image et de ses discontinuités par champ markovien a pour objectif dans la restauration d'image de préserver les contours.
